要提高WordPress主题开发人员的技能和实践以实现最佳质量,需要遵循一系列的最佳实践,并且不断学习和实践新的技术和方法,以下是一些关键点,可以帮助开发人员提升他们的主题开发技能:
(图片来源网络,侵删)1、理解 WordPress 核心:
学习并熟悉 WordPress 的核心代码和函数库。
阅读官方的WordPress开发文档,了解如何正确地使用钩子(hooks)、过滤器(filters)和短代码(shortcodes)。
2、掌握 PHP, HTML, CSS, 和 JavaScript:
确保对 PHP 有深入的了解,因为它是 WordPress 的基础。
精通 HTML 和 CSS 来创建响应式和兼容各种浏览器的主题。
学习 JavaScript (以及其流行的库和框架,如jQuery) 来增强用户界面和体验。
3、使用现代开发工具:
使用版本控制系统,如Git,来管理代码变更和协作。
利用文本编辑器或IDE(如Visual Studio Code, Sublime Text等)的高级功能来提高效率。
4、编写干净、可维护的代码:
遵循编码标准和最佳实践,例如WordPress编码标准。
保持代码简洁明了,避免冗余和复杂的构造。
注释你的代码,特别是复杂的函数和逻辑。
5、使用动作和过滤器:
通过动作和过滤器修改和增强WordPress的功能,而不是直接修改核心文件。
避免使用已弃用的功能,这有助于确保主题与未来的WordPress版本兼容。
6、构建响应式设计:
使用媒体查询来创建适应不同屏幕尺寸的布局。
测试主题在不同设备和分辨率下的外观和功能。
7、优化性能:
最小化CSS和JavaScript文件的大小。
使用缓存策略和懒加载技术来提高页面加载速度。
优化数据库查询和使用高效的数据检索方法。
8、安全性:
遵循安全最佳实践,如防止SQL注入和跨站脚本(XSS)攻击。
定期更新主题及其依赖项以修补安全漏洞。
9、测试和调试:
使用单元测试和功能测试来验证代码的正确性。
使用调试工具来诊断和解决错误。
10、用户体验(UX)设计:
关注用户体验设计,确保主题的用户界面直观易用。
根据用户的反馈进行迭代设计。
11、学习和贡献于社区:
参与WordPress社区,从其他开发者那里学习经验。
贡献代码到开源项目,或者参与论坛和讨论组。
12、持续学习:
跟踪最新的Web开发趋势和技术。
参加研讨会、网络研讨会和其他教育课程来提高自己的技能。
通过上述的实践和不断的学习,WordPress主题开发人员可以显著提高他们的技能,并开发出高质量、高性能和安全的主题,记住,成为一个优秀的开发人员是一个持续的过程,永远有新的东西可以学习和改进。
最新评论
本站CDN与莫名CDN同款、亚太CDN、速度还不错,值得推荐。
感谢推荐我们公司产品、有什么活动会第一时间公布!
我在用这类站群服务器、还可以. 用很多年了。